Ice art debuts Friday

Paul Wertin with Kevin and Ken of Alpine Ice enjoy the only sunny day thus far during their installation of Arches for The Seventh Annual Triumph Winterfest. Influenced by Christo and Jeanne-Claude’s environmental public art installations, Wertin is transforming the landscape along the Gore Creek Promenade to create an interactive experience for all ages to enjoy. The ice sculpture installation which is illuminated in the evening by controllable LED lights includes 120 blocks of ice weighing 36,000 pounds total. Arches will open Friday, January 17 at 5pm along the Gore Creek Promenade in Vail Village. Visit www.artinvail.com for more information.
